Asbestos Service in Essex County, NJ
Asbestos services encompass a range of inspections, testing, and removal procedures for homeowners and property owners concerned about asbestos-containing materials in their buildings. These services typically address projects such as identifying asbestos in older walls, ceilings, insulation, flooring, or roofing, and safely removing or encapsulating the material to prevent health risks. Property owners often seek these services before renovations, demolitions, or when purchasing a property with potential asbestos issues, aiming to ensure the safety of occupants and compliance with local regulations.
Before requesting asbestos services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the inspection, the types of materials that may contain asbestos, and the safety measures involved in removal or containment processes. It is important to know whether testing is necessary to confirm asbestos presence and to discuss the options for safe remediation. Clear communication about the project's extent and potential costs can help in making informed decisions about managing asbestos risks in residential or commercial properties.

Common Asbestos Service Jobs
Asbestos Inspection - identifying the presence of asbestos in building materials during property assessments.
Asbestos Testing - collecting samples for laboratory analysis to determine asbestos content.
Asbestos Removal - safely eliminating asbestos-containing materials from residential or commercial properties.
Asbestos Abatement - implementing procedures to contain and reduce asbestos exposure risks.
Asbestos Encapsulation - sealing asbestos materials to prevent fiber release and minimize disturbance.
Asbestos Disposal - proper handling and disposal of asbestos waste following safety regulations.
